Difference between revisions of "256a-fall-2020/final"

From CCRMA Wiki
Jump to: navigation, search
Line 1: Line 1:
 
= Final Project: Interactive Audiovisual System =
 
= Final Project: Interactive Audiovisual System =
  
== Proposals ==
+
== Part 1: Proposals ==
 
'''due: in class on Monday (11/2)'''
 
'''due: in class on Monday (11/2)'''
  
Line 32: Line 32:
 
Be prepared to present succinctly in class.  Please upload your proposals and design sketches to Canvas!
 
Be prepared to present succinctly in class.  Please upload your proposals and design sketches to Canvas!
  
== Milestone Critique ==
+
== Part 2: Milestone Critique ==
 
'''due: in class on Monday (11/9)'''
 
'''due: in class on Monday (11/9)'''
  
== Final Deliverables ==
+
== Part 3: Final Deliverables + Presentation ==
 
* '''all materials (video, webpage, code): due on Canvas on Wednesday (11/18) noon'''
 
* '''all materials (video, webpage, code): due on Canvas on Wednesday (11/18) noon'''
 
* '''final (public) presentations: Wednesday (11/18) starting at 4pm, continuing to after class as needed.
 
* '''final (public) presentations: Wednesday (11/18) starting at 4pm, continuing to after class as needed.

Revision as of 12:51, 31 October 2020

Final Project: Interactive Audiovisual System

Part 1: Proposals

due: in class on Monday (11/2)

  • deliverables: three ideas, sketched out, ready to present
    • maximally different from each other
    • try to articulate as much specificity as possible!
    • ideas sketched out e.g., on paper
    • a short paragraph explaining each idea
    • (optional) some code working -- if there's a core critical part at the center of your idea, make sure you'll be able to do it early on
  • what must your final project have:
    • real-time audio/music, graphics, interaction
    • a software system
  • what can it be?
    • tool, toy, game, instrument
    • or some other, unclassifiable artifact
  • what must it NOT be:
    • a sequencer (though it can contain a sequencer)
    • a playlist generator (NOOOOOO)
    • a music recommendation system (NOOOOOO)
  • allowed programming environments:
    • Chunity (ChucK + Unity)
    • OR C++ with ChucK embedded (like the visualizer)
    • anything else must be approved by us

Be prepared to present succinctly in class. Please upload your proposals and design sketches to Canvas!

Part 2: Milestone Critique

due: in class on Monday (11/9)

Part 3: Final Deliverables + Presentation

  • all materials (video, webpage, code): due on Canvas on Wednesday (11/18) noon
  • final (public) presentations: Wednesday (11/18) starting at 4pm, continuing to after class as needed.